Second order fluid flow between two parallel plates when one of them moves with velocity $U(t)$
Theoretical and applied mechanics, Tome 15 (1989) no. 1, p. 93
Cet article a éte moissonné depuis la source eLibrary of Mathematical Institute of the Serbian Academy of Sciences and Arts
The technique is used to study the movement of a fluid between two infinite parallel plates, one of which moves with a speed $U(t)$. Differential equations are integrated and interesting conclusions are drawn.
